服务器MYSQL备份方法
我不是以mysqldump来备份的,因为是要备份服务器上的MYSQL数据库,只要用直接拷贝DATA下的所有文件即可。
MYSQL装在E:\PHPsetup\mysql\data,备份文件放D:\beifen\1;D:\beifen\2;D:\beifen\3;D:\beifen\4;D:\beifen\5;D:\beifen\6;D:\beifen\7,按照一个星期七天来设定的。
把deltree拷入c:\windows目录,把如下内容放入1.bat
net stop mysql
net stop w3svc
net stop iisadmin /y
deltree /y D:\beifen\1\.
xcopy /e E:\PHPsetup\mysql\data D:\beifen\1
net start w3svc
net start mysql
意思为:
1、停止mysql服务
2、停止IIS服务
3、删除D:\beifen\1\目录下所有内容,然后把E:\PHPsetup\mysql\data目录下的内容全部拷贝入 D:\beifen\1目录,以达到备份数据库的目的(要恢复时,只要把 D:\beifen\1下的内容拷回E:\PHPsetup\mysql\data目录即可)。
4、启动IIS服务
5、启动mysql服务
然后把1.bat加到任务计划里即可,设定时间为每星期一的3:00,这时较闲。
把2.bat加到任务计划里即可,设定时间为每星期二的3:00,以此类推!
如果不停止mysql iis服务的话,有时会出现文件正在被使用,拷贝不了的情况。
当前页面是本站的「Google AMP」版。查看和发表评论请点击:完整版 »
因本文不是用Markdown格式的编辑器书写的,转换的页面可能不符合AMP标准。